COURSE DEFINITIONThis interdisciplinary course that combines both practice and theory, concentrates on memory studies and the hybrid genre of essay film. The forms that approach the images and concepts of production critically; different usages of various visual and audio material such as photograph, video, animation, sound, illustration, found image and found footage are explained within the context of works of the pioneer directors of memory and photo essay and essay films are produced by the means of the theoretical knowledge.

RECOMENDED OR REQUIRED READINGAlter, Nora. (2007) "Translating the Essay into Film and Installation", Journal of Visual Culture, 6(1).
Boyarin, Jonathan (ed.) Remapping Memory: The Politics of Time and Space
Beckman, Karen; Ma, Jean (2008) Still Moving: Between Cinema and Photography, Duke University Press Books
Corrigan, Timothy (2011) The Essay Film: From Montaigne, After Marker, Oxford University Press
Corrigan, Timothy (2008) "The Forgotten Image Between Two Shots": Photos, Photograms, and the Essayistic? Still Moving: Between Cinema and Photography, ed. Karen Beckman and Jean Ma, Duke University Press.
Citron, Michelle (1998) Home Movies and Other Necessary Fictions, University of Minnesota Press.
Lebow, Alisa (2012) The Cinema of Me: The Self and Subjectivity in First Person Documentary, Wallflower Press.
Marks, Laura. (2000) The Skin of the Film: Intercultural Cinema, Embodiment, and the Senses. Duke University Press,
Mitchell, W.J.T. "What Happened to the Essay" the Chicago Tribune on-line site
Proust, Marcel. (2005). In Search of Lost Time. Scott Moncrieff and Terence Kilmartin trans. London: Vintage Books.
Rascaroli, Laura (2008) The Essay Film: Problems, Definitions, Textual Commitments, The Journal of Cinema and Media, 49:2, 24-47
Russell, Catherine (1999) Experimental Ethnography: The Work of Film in the Age of Video, Duke University Press Books
Terdiman, Richard. (1993) Present Past: Modernity and the Memory Crisis. Cornell University Press.
Warren, Charles (1996) Beyond Document: Essays on Nonfiction Film, Middletown,CT: Wesleyan Univesity Press.
